The magnetic nanoparticles with core diameter 10 nm were modified by poly-L-lysine to bind antibody for cancer cell detection. Prepared biocompatible magnetic fluid (MFPLL) was characterized by dynamic light scattering method to obtain the particle size distribution. Magnetoelectric multiferroics are materials which exhibit both magnetic order and ferroelectricity in the same phase. Multiferroic materials, where ferroelectricity and magnetism coexist, were extensively studied.
